Houseperson
About the role
The Springhill Suites by Marriott Denver at Anschutz Medical Campus is seeking a Hotel Housekeeping Houseperson.
Responsibilities
- Assisting room attendants by delivering linens, toiletries, and cleaning supplies.
- Cleaning public areas such as hallways, lobbies, elevators, stairwells, and meeting rooms.
- Removing trash and replacing garbage bags in common areas.
- Ensuring that housekeeping closets and carts are stocked and organized.
- Auxiliary in deep cleaning tasks as needed.
- Responding to guest requests for additional towels, pillows, blankets, or other amenities.
- Auxiliary in luggage handling when required.
- Collecting, sorting, and delivering clean and soiled linens between housekeeping and laundry.
- Replacing bed linens and towels in designated areas as needed.
- Auxiliary in setting up banquet rooms, conference rooms, and event spaces.
- Moving and arranging furniture when necessary for guest needs or maintenance.
- Reporting maintenance issues such as plumbing, electrical, or HVAC problems to the engineering department.
- Following hotel safety procedures and security policies.
- Ensuring compliance with sanitation and hygiene standards.
